Examine This Report on Excel Links Not Working

Wiki Article

The 3-Minute Rule for Excel Links Not Working

Table of ContentsExcel Links Not Working for DummiesThe Ultimate Guide To Excel Links Not WorkingThe smart Trick of Excel Links Not Working That Nobody is DiscussingExcel Links Not Working for BeginnersGetting My Excel Links Not Working To WorkA Biased View of Excel Links Not WorkingGetting The Excel Links Not Working To Work
formula)> 0 after that A time overhanging exists for each contact us to a user-defined feature and also for each and every transfer of information from Excel to VBA. In some cases one multi-cell variety formula user-defined feature can aid you decrease these expenses by integrating numerous feature calls right into a solitary function with a multi-cell input variety that returns a range of answers.

Calculation time for these features is proportionate to the variety of cells covered, so try to lessen the variety of cells that the functions are referencing. Make use of the wildcard personalities (any kind of solitary personality) as well as (no character or any number of personalities) in the standards for indexed arrays as component of the,,,, and other functions.

Intend the numbers that you intend to cumulatively are in column A, and you desire column B to consist of the collective sum; you can do either of the following: You can create a formula in column B such as =AMOUNT($A$ 1:$A2) as well as drag it down as for you need. The beginning cell of the amount is secured in A1, but because the finishing cell has a relative row recommendation, it instantly boosts for every row.

Excitement About Excel Links Not Working

This determines the collective cell by adding this row's number to the previous collective. For 1,000 rows, the initial technique makes Excel do concerning 500,000 computations, yet the second technique makes Excel do just around 2,000 calculations. When you have multiple sorted indexes to a table (for instance, Website within Location) you can often conserve substantial calculation time by dynamically computing the address of a subset array of rows (or columns) to use in the or feature.

Other functions. The Accumulated function is a powerful and effective way of determining 19 different techniques of accumulating information (such as,, and also ).

Starting in Excel 2007, you should utilize,, and works as opposed to the DFunctions. Use the following ideas to develop faster VBA macros. To boost efficiency for VBA macros, clearly switch off the functionality that is not needed while your code implements. Commonly, one recalculation or one revise after your code runs is all that is needed as well as can boost efficiency.

Top Guidelines Of Excel Links Not Working

excel links not workingexcel links not working


The following performance can generally be switched off while your VBA macro carries out: Transform off screen updating. If is readied to, Excel does not revise the display. While your code runs, the screen updates swiftly, as well as it is typically not required for the user to see each upgrade. Updating the screen when, after the code implements, boosts efficiency.

If is set to, Excel does not present the condition bar - excel links not working. The status bar setting is separate from the display updating establishing to ensure that you can still display the standing of the present operation even while the screen is not upgrading. Nonetheless, if you don't need to show the standing of every operation, transforming off the status bar while your code runs additionally boosts efficiency.

excel links not workingexcel links not working

If is set to, Excel only computes the workbook when the customer explicitly starts the computation. In automatic estimation mode, Excel figures out when to determine. Every time a cell worth that is related to a formula changes, Excel recalculates the formula. If you switch over the computation setting to manual, you can wait till all the cells connected with the formula are updated prior to recalculating the workbook.

Some Of Excel Links Not Working

Switch off events. If is readied to, Excel does not elevate events. If there are add-ins listening for Excel occasions, those add-ins eat sources on the computer system as they tape-record the occasions. If it is not essential for the add-in to tape the occasions that occur while your code runs, turning off events enhances performance.

If is set to, Excel does not show page breaks. It's not required to recalculate web page breaks while your code runs, and also computing the web page breaks after the code carries out enhances performance.

Screen, Upgrading standing, Bar, State = Application. Show, Condition, Bar calc, State = Application. Calculation occasions, State = Application.

About Excel Links Not Working

Calculation = xl, Calculation, Handbook Application. Enable, Events = False' Note: this is a sheet-level setup. Display, Updating = screen, Update, State Application.

Enable, Events = events, State' Note: this is a sheet-level setup Energetic, Sheet. Display, Page, Breaks = screen, Web page, Breaks, State Enhance your code by clearly lowering the number of times data is transferred in between Excel and your code.

The adhering to code example reveals non-optimized code page that loops via cells individually to get and set the values of cells A1: C10000. These read this cells do not contain formulas. Dim Data, Variety as Variety Dim Irow as Long Dim Icol as Integer Dim My, Var as Double Set Information, Variety=Variety("A1: C10000") For Irow=1 to 10000 For icol=1 to 3' Read the worths from the Excel grid 30,000 times.

Rumored Buzz on Excel Links Not Working

My, Var=My, Var * Myvar' Create the worths back into the Excel grid 30,000 times. Data, Array(Irow, Icol)=My, Var End If Following Icol Next Irow The complying with code example shows optimized code that makes use of a selection to obtain and also establish the worths of cells A1: C10000 all at the exact same time. These cells don't contain solutions.

Information, Variety = Range("A1: C10000"). Value2 For Irow = 1 To 10000 For Icol = 1 To 3 My, Var = Information, Variety(Irow, Icol) If My, Var > 0 Then' Adjustment the values in the range. My, Var=My, Var * Myvar Data, Array(Irow, Icol) = My, Var End If Next Icol Next Irow' Write all the worths back right into the variety at as soon as.

Value2 = Information, Variety returns the formatted worth of a cell. This is slow-moving, can return ### if the customer zooms, as well as can lose accuracy. returns a VBA currency or VBA day variable if the array was formatted as Day or Currency. This is sluggish, can lose accuracy, and can create errors when calling worksheet features.

Rumored Buzz on Excel Links Not Working

The adhering you can try these out to code examples compare the two techniques. The adhering to code instance reveals non-optimized code that selects each Forming on the active sheet and also transforms the text to "Hi".

Forms. Count Active, Sheet. Shapes(i). Select Selection. Text="Hi" Next i The complying with code instance shows optimized code that recommendations each Shape directly as well as alters the message to "Hello there". For i = 0 To Energetic, Sheet. Forms. Count Energetic, Sheet. Forms(i). Text, Result. Text="Hello" Next i The adhering to is a listing of additional efficiency optimizations you can use in your VBA code: Return results by designating a variety straight to a.

Report this wiki page